What's the point in taking gear from weapon racks?

Are they suppose to be useful in deconstruction or selling them for gold because they don't seem to offer any experience deconstructing and they sell for 0 gold. Is this a bug or the way it should work?

    The way is was supposed to work when it was introduced, is that if you had broken gear out in the field or in delve, you could grab some of this white gear and keep going.

    Now as far as why the gear in town is complete garbage is because too many players were running around stealing the gear and making bank off of it. White staffs, shields, and two handed weapons were selling for 52 most with very little chance of getting caught. It was never intended to be a viable way to level professions or make gold.

    They have tried to strike a strange balance between providing a world that feels "real" while also not giving a free and easy source of gold and skill leveling.

    I believe they are mostly included for "role playing purposes". It makes sense that items lying on a table can actually be picked up rather than being glued to the furniture, and someone might want to role play a poor person who spends all their earned gold on drinks and gambling and never buys or crafts anything.

    Those items give very little inspiration when deconstructing, but not quite zero, so they are of some very limited use for leveling up the craft. On rare occasions you also get an ingot out of them. When you are fresh out of Coldharbour and have absolutely no other weapon or armor of the correct type, they are sort of useful for a short while until you have found a few material nodes and can craft better gear and weapons yourself.

    The way I heard it, it was (often) asked by players to make more objects in the world, like armor and weapon stands, be able to interact with. After all, you could already filch (non-buff) food stuffs from tables, but the weapons all seemed glued to their stands? Not very likely. So to make the world feel a little bit more lived in, this feature was added.

    Of course, in order to not disturb the economy and unbalance crafting, these items have neither value, nor attributes, attached to them.

    Not even close, they didn't exist at launch. All the racks were decorative and non interactive. Then later they made them and food you saw actually able the be picked up. This was before the justice system so there was no penalty for picking them up. This meant they had to make them worth 0 with low inspiration and low chance of mats at deconstruction. They are just there to add to the environment, nothing more.

    I like taking items from the racks or ones that are just laying about, especially armor pieces, and improving them and enchanting them for my own use. The reason being the look of the item. For example I have a favorite helmet that I liked the look of at lower levels, but when crafting it at higher levels it became too ornate and looked rather silly. By finding it in world, I get a helmet that looks like the low level helm but is scaled to my level. In fact, I even keep track of where I have found it so I can get another one when I've leveled up enough to need a new one.
